Iraqi embassy

They sure were in a hurry when they left the Iraqi embassy to East Germany in 1991. Papers were strewn everywhere, files, important documents, files, letters, photos, names, addresses; mountains of them – everything left behind.

It’s still abandoned to this day, but of course it has deteriorated over the years since AB’s first visit in 2010.

The pictures below are from 2014. The intervening years took their toll…

By the time 2023 rolled around, the Iraqi embassy was a blackened shell. Some people like it that way.
